Justice Denied - for a Time

A daughter is murdered by the son of a very wealthy man. The son is tried and convicted, and sentenced to death by lethal injection. What if the wealthy father, aware that the appeal processes will not free his son, uses his vast resources and connections to surreptitiously defeat the will of the people?This is the premise of Andrew Neiderman's In Double Jeopardy. It is a well written novel that not only takes a reader down a not improbable path of conspiracy and deception, but it also does a very good job of showing the consequences of a violent crime on the victim's surviving family.While the suspenseful moments in the novel do not occur mainly until near the conclusion, the planning, "execution" (pun intended) and aftermath of the son's avoidance of the death penalty make this novel a fascinating read. The characters, particularly the father of the murdered daughter, are convincing. A great deal of thought went into the writing of this novel, and it would be an enjoyable read for fans of thrillers and the X Files.
